This vehicle is equipped with a Bosch ABS/SCB/TC/VSC module.
This module provides the following vehicle performance enhancement systems:
- Antilock Brake System (ABS)
- Electric Parking Brake (EBP apply and EPB release (automatic)
- Extended Hill Start Assist (EHSA)
- Regenerative Braking (in conjunction with the Eboost module)
- Electronic Brake Distribution
- Traction Control (TC)
- Vehicle Stability Control (VSC)
The following components are involved in the operation of the above systems:
- Electronic brake control module (EBCM) - The EBCM controls the system functions and detects failures.
The EBCM contains the following components:
- System relay - The system relay is internal to the EBCM. The system relay is energized when the power button is placed in ON/RUN or a remote function actuation (RFA) commands remote START. The system relay supplies battery positive voltage to the valve solenoids and to the ABS pump motor. This voltage is referred to as system voltage.
- Solenoids - The solenoids are commanded ON and OFF by the EBCM to operate the appropriate valves in the brake pressure modulator valve.
- Brake pressure modulator valve - The brake pressure modulator valve uses a 4-circuit configuration to control hydraulic pressure to each wheel independently.
The brake pressure modulator valve contains the following components:
- ABS pump motor and pump
- Isolation valves
- Dump valves
- Electronic hydraulic control unit
- Steering angle sensor--The EBCM receives serial data message inputs from the steering angle sensor. The steering angle sensor signal is used to calculate the desired yaw rate. The steering angle sensor is mounted internally to the electric power steering gear.
- Traction control switch--Traction control and stability control are manually disabled or enabled by pressing the traction control switch.
- Multi-axis acceleration sensor--The yaw rate, lateral acceleration and longitudinal acceleration sensors are combined into one multi-axis acceleration sensor. The EBCM receives serial data message inputs from the yaw rate, lateral acceleration and longitudinal acceleration sensor and activates stability control depending on multi-axis acceleration sensor input.
Depending on vehicle options, the vehicle multi-axis sensor may be installed internal to the inflatable restraint sensing diagnostic module, separately externally or a combination of both. Confirm with vehicle RPO codes and schematics.
- Wheel speed sensors - The wheel speeds are detected by active wheel speed sensors and encoder rings. The encoder ring consists of permanent magnets. Each wheel speed sensor receives ignition voltage from the electronic brake control module (EBCM) and provides a DC square wave signal back to the module. As the wheel spins, the EBCM uses the frequency of the square wave signal to calculate the wheel speed.
- Electronic park brake motors - Controlled by the EBCM and attached to each rear caliper.
